Like the majority of Hotels in Venice, Residenza Goldoni does not have a lift, and some of the rooms are on the 4th floor, up very steep, narrow stairs. You should specify in advance if you require accomodation close to the ground floor.
Residenza Goldoni is unusual however in that it can be easily reached from the vaporetto stop at Rialto Bridge, without crossing any bridges or negotiating any steps.
...
Clean, comfortable accomodation in an excellent location, with friendly, helpful staff - reasonably priced by Venice standards.

Breakfast was very basic and was only available between 8am - 9:30am which makes it difficult if you need to depart earlier. The language barrier was challenging at times, but we managed to get by. Note the hotel requests payment by cash or travellers cheque, however if you clarify at the time of booking, credit cards are accepted.
...
The web site should note there is no lift. We identified this prior to our arrival, however some guests may have trouble negotiating the stairs to the higher floors, particularly the third and fourth!
...
This centrally located hotel offers very compact rooms which are clean & cosy. If you can climb 4 flights of stairs with your bags make sure you confirm you get the terrace room and remember the mosquito spray! (Enjoy a pizza & Vino out there!) You'll need to get confirmation in writing at time of booking to make final payment by credit card.
